Garden Fresh Vegetable Bake with a Cheesy Twist (Page 2 ) | May 28, 2024
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F).
In a large pan, heat the o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and sauté until translucent.
Add the diced potatoes to the pan and cook for about 5 minutes.
Stir in the chopped cabbage, grated carrot, diced green peppers, and red pepper. Cook for another 5 minutes.
Season the vegetable mixture with chili powder, black pepper, and salt. Mix well and remove from heat.
In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, yogurt, oil, flour, salt, black pepper, and baking powder until smooth.
Stir in the grated cheddar cheese and parsley.
Grease a baking dish and spread the vegetable mixture evenly on the bottom.
Pour the egg and cheese mixture over the vegetables.
Bake for about 40-45 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and set.
Allow the casserole to cool slightly before slicing and serving.
